Key Insights into Jamie Scott’s Culinary World

How do you create new recipes?
“I mix ideas from traditional recipes with modern dietary trends, aiming for a balance of flavor, nutrition, and presentation.”

Where do you find new cooking ideas?
“I get many ideas from traveling and reading. When I see how different cultures cook or read new cookbooks or food articles, it gives me fresh ideas to try in my kitchen.”

What’s a simple ingredient you like to use?
“Lentils. They’re easy to cook, healthy, and can be used in many dishes, like soups and salads. They’re also a great source of protein if you don’t eat meat.”

What is your favorite cooking method?
“I really like slow cooking. It’s a great way to make food tender and delicious without doing much work. You just let time and low heat do the job.”

What’s a cooking skill you want to get better at?
“I’m really interested in learning more about fermenting food. It’s a neat way to keep food from going bad and can make flavors that are really deep and interesting. I can’t wait to try more of it.”
